Aryan Ibex lifts Ladakh Premier League T-20 Cup

Excelsior Sports Correspondent

LEH, Sept 29: Aryan Ibex lifted the Ladakh Premier League T/20 Cup, organised by Fire and Fury Corps under Sadbhavana project at Nawang Dorjay Stobdan (NDS) Stadium, here today.
The three weeks long tournament commenced on September 13 and witnessed some scintillating Cricket. It also witnessed individuals from a variety of cultures and backgrounds reaching new heights together and connecting with each other through cricket.
The tournament was played in two phases with Phase-I being concluded at five Zones viz Nubra, Kargil, Karu, Nyoma and Leh. Two teams each from all Zones fully sponsored by local Army formations have participated in Phase-II being conducted at NDS Stadium.
Today’s in a nail biting and exhilarating match Aryan Ibex scored 172 runs and in return team Maryul Tigers scored 165 runs in stipulated 20 overs and lost the match by 7 runs.
LAHDC Leh Chief Executive Councillor Advocate Tashi Gyalson graced the ceremony as chief guest and gave away prizes to teams along with SS Khandare, IPS, ADGP Ladakh Police and Major General Akash Kaushik, Chief of Staff Headquarters 14 Corps.
CEC Tashi Gyalson in his speech appreciates the Army for organizing the tournament and added that such a platform helps the budding sports person from Ladakh region to reach at National and International level.
The prizes included winners and runners up trophies with cash award Rs. 25,000 and Rs. 20,000 each bagged by Aryan Ibex & Maryul Tigers’ team, while consolation cash award of Rs 5000 was given to all participating teams. Other awards including best bowler award was bagged by Stanzin Dorjay, while best batsman award was bagged by Rigzen Dorjay and man of the match went to Lobzang Timet besides man of series award clinched by Rigzen Dorjay.
